Have you ever watched a movie that had a poor quality soundtrack. Maybe the speakers are faulty or maybe the DVD or video is damaged in some way. Regardless of the cause, the reality is that your viewing pleasure is severely diminished. Sound is vitally important to this visual medium that people long to have a home theater sound system that is top of the range. Top sound systems where traditionally expensive but this has changed over the last few years and pretty much most people can get a great home theater sound system. This article will go into the considerations when getting such a system to maximize your viewing pleasure.

If you're thinking about improving your home theater system, but are concerned about the cost and difficultly then relax. By doing some homework, you can improve it without breaking the bank. Get to know the various components you need for a good home theater sound system, and comparison shop the Internet for the best prices.

The first thing you should know before trying to overhaul your home theater sound system is to find what you really want to change about it. Know the problems you encounter on it. Does the sound of the stereo bother you? Maybe your speakers need upgrading. Know also what kind of stereo you want. There are surround sound system and Dolby bass system. Not all stereo systems are appropriate for a home theater.

To find out how you can improve your home theater sound system, it is a good idea to get an expert to look at it. A knowledgeable person can tell you with more certainty if any of your equipment could use repairs or replacements. Then, if necessary, you can find appropriate equipment yourself at a home electronics store.

The Internet is a good place to start. Browse the equipment sold online. Of course, you'll want manufacturers you can trust who won't also break your bottom line. Look into warranties. And always, always, try before you buy any home theater sound system. Electronics stores offer you the chance to listen and learn so don't make any quick decisions.

The smart way to find out whether the home theater sound system you're considering will create the sound you are seeking is to check out the options. You need to visit a home electronics store where you can listen to various systems in a room built for that purpose. Then, you need to "test drive" equipment from various companies and note your likes and dislikes. But don't buy just yet--your best option, once you've settled on a system, is to shop online to find the best price.

When all your components are ready, all you have to do is install your system. Getting the right locations for your speakers in you living room is just as important as getting the right components. Take some care when doing this. Play a few movies and adjust the locations of the speakers until you think it just right. It may mean watching a few movies but we all have a cross to bear, maybe have a bucket of popcorn to make the job a bit more palatable. Finally, check that the wires aren't in danger of being tripped on and ripped out, and your home theater sound system should be ready to go.

LCD, DLP and LCOS are three projector technologies which are predominantly used in schools, colleges and corporate houses for giving presentations, watching videos, classroom teaching, product training etc. LCD projectors use LCD (Liquid Crystal Display) technology to display text and image on an interactive whiteboard or other projection screen. They are also known as multimedia projectors as they can display both text and images from PC, TV and video recorders. They can work with all types of notebooks and desktops. The projection can be of SVGA or XGA resolution.

SVGA means 800 * 600 resolutions whereas XGA means 1024 * 768 screen resolution. A digital image is made up of dots or pixels. A resolution is the size of the digital image which is expressed in width * Height. For e.g.: 800 * 600 resolution means, an image is 800 pixels wide and 600 pixels in height. The projector brightness is measured in ANSI (American National Standard Institute) Lumens.

The DLP and LCOS projectors are also considered to be a type of LCD projector although they use DLP (Digital Light Processing) and LCOS (Liquid Crystal on Silicon) technologies for video projection.

LCD technology is best for computer use and DLP is best for projecting videos. LCD delivers better color saturation, sharper image and is more light efficient than DLP. The DLP projectors are smaller and lighter than LCD and produce higher contrast videos.

LCOS technology is best for very high resolutions. Its projectors are bigger and heavier than LCD and DLP and generally cost more. One practical application of LCD technology is its use by teachers when training students to use software by capturing the image say 'Screen of MSWord' from a computer screen and projecting it on the interactive whiteboard so that all the students can see what is going on the computer screen.
